CycloneII-JTAG Mode

Hi, I'm using CycloneII(EP2C8Q208).

my problem is can't configure jtag mode.

so i checked pin number. but i couldn't found error.

and i checked power supply but that's working.

i using usb_blaster. and usb_blaster is working.

help me!! It's crazy for me!!

    You haven't mentioned what error is shown by QUARTUSII.

    Have you tried the following?

    1. Assignments>Device>Device and Pin options> Configuration

    select configuration scheme as active serial

    2. Assignments>Device>Device and Pin options> unused pins as input tri-stated

    3. In the programmer select mode as JTAG

    4. And the file to select is .sof and not .pof

    Thank you Altera Pupil.

    but it didn't work and show this message.

    "Unable to scan device chain. Can't scan JTAG mode."

    ps. I connected usb_blaster i clicked Auto detect.

    Hi,

    This error happens when QUARTUSII can't detect the device for programming.

    possible reasons

    1. If u r using more than one device for programming and QUARTUSII detects some mismatch in no: of devices.

    2.JTAG server is not running.

    3.May be u r system requires driver for USB-blaster.

    The most easy way to see, if the Quartus programmer is actually accessing the USB Blaster is to watch the blue LED.

    If USB Blaster is accessed, but can't scan the device chain, there's most likely a hardware issue with the board. The Quartus Programmer has debugging functions to trace the JTAG signals in this case.
